October 2, 2020 Solon Community, The Iowa Department of Public Health issued new guidance related to when to quarantine and what type of face covering offers the greatest protection. The guidance is summarized below: • Quarantines will not be required when a masked individual tests positive and all close contacts were wearing masks. Close contacts will need to self-monitor. • Masks offer the greatest protection from COVID spread. Gaiters and shields do not offer the same level of protection as masks. The administrative team and nurses met this morning to review our current mitigation practices and the new guidance from the IDPH. We concluded that all current mitigation practices will continue to be implemented and our face covering expectation will encourage the use of masks to offer students and staff the greatest level of protection. The IDPH recognizes the use of masks as protection when social distancing is compromised so the use of masks is an important mitigation practice in keeping all students onsite everyday. If your child currently uses a shield or gaiter and you have questions, please contact your child’s school principal. The success of our return to onsite learning for all students everyday has been a model across Iowa. We will continue to assess and review our data and all new guidance from public health and Department of Education in keeping all students and staff safely onsite.
